Guayaquil Squirrel vs Manu Antbird
Sciurus stramineus compared with Cercomacra manu
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Guayaquil Squirrel | Manu Antbird |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Passeriformes (Songbirds) |
| Family | Sciuridae (Squirrels) | Thamnophilidae |
| Genus | Sciurus (Tree Squirrels) | Cercomacra |
| Species | Sciurus stramineus | Cercomacra manu |
Evolutionary Relationship
Guayaquil Squirrel and Manu Antbird share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
